რა არის SQL Sharding?
რა არის SQL Sharding?

ვიდეო: რა არის SQL Sharding?

ვიდეო: რა არის SQL Sharding?
ვიდეო: Justin Shi: Blockchain, Cryptocurrency and the Achilles Heel in Software Developments 2024, ნოემბერი
Anonim

შარდინგი ა SQL სერვერის მონაცემთა ბაზა. შარდინგი , თავის არსში, არის ერთიანი, დიდი მონაცემთა ბაზის დაშლა რამდენიმე პატარა, თვითშეზღუდულ მონაცემთა ბაზებად. ეს ჩვეულებრივ კეთდება კომპანიების მიერ, რომლებსაც სჭირდებათ მონაცემების ლოგიკურად დაშლა, მაგალითად SaaS პროვაიდერის მიერ კლიენტის მონაცემების სეგრეგირება.

შესაბამისად, რა იგულისხმება დაქუცმაცებაში?

შარდინგი არის მონაცემთა ბაზის დაყოფის ტიპი, რომელიც ჰყოფს ძალიან დიდ მონაცემთა ბაზებს პატარა, უფრო სწრაფ, უფრო ადვილად მართვად ნაწილებად, რომელსაც ეწოდება მონაცემთა ფრაგმენტები. Სიტყვა ნატეხი ნიშნავს მთლიანის მცირე ნაწილი.

ასევე, რა განსხვავებაა დაყოფასა და გაფანტვას შორის? დაქუცმაცება არის განაწილება ან დანაყოფი მონაცემთა მრავალჯერადი განსხვავებული მანქანები ხოლო დაყოფა არის მონაცემთა განაწილება იმავე მანქანაზე“.

ამის გათვალისწინებით, როგორ მუშაობს მონაცემთა ბაზის გაზიარება?

Sharding არის ერთი ლოგიკური მონაცემთა მრავალჯერადად გაყოფისა და შენახვის მეთოდი მონაცემთა ბაზები . მონაცემთა განაწილებით მრავალ მანქანას შორის, კლასტერი მონაცემთა ბაზა სისტემები შეუძლია შეინახეთ უფრო დიდი მონაცემთა ნაკრები და დაამუშავეთ დამატებითი მოთხოვნები. შარდინგი საშუალებას აძლევს ა მონაცემთა ბაზა კლასტერი მასშტაბით, მის მონაცემებთან და ტრაფიკის ზრდასთან ერთად.

რომელი Azure SQL მონაცემთა ბაზის ფუნქცია იყენებს გაზიარებას?

იმისათვის, რომ ადვილად შემცირდეს მონაცემთა ბაზები on SQL Azure , გამოყენება ა ნატეხი რუქის მენეჯერი. The ნატეხი რუქის მენეჯერი განსაკუთრებულია მონაცემთა ბაზა რომელიც ინახავს გლობალური რუკების ინფორმაციას ყველა ნატეხის შესახებ ( მონაცემთა ბაზები ) ში ნატეხი კომპლექტი.

გირჩევთ: